Overview
This position is responsible for providing advanced technical support to data processing systems. Analyzes existing and proposed data processing systems or procedures that improve processing capabilities. Assists the installation of programs and procedures developed in coordination with end user groups. Enhances data processing systems and procedures through system analysis, coding, testing, and other activities that facilitate technical business objectives. May occasionally guide less experienced analysts in the work group. Responsibilities & Qualifications Duties & Responsibilities: Data Analysis - Sources, compiles, and interprets data. Performs analysis for accuracy and efficiencies, effectively communicates analysis output. System Testing - Thoroughly tests systems to ensure proper installation of new software, system changes, and overall efficiency. Evaluates and conveys testing results. Performs coding and assists in implementing system modifications and enhancements. Business Support - Provides technical support by performing coding, ensuring processes run smoothly, and working to continuously improve processing capabilities. Works closely with business units and operation teams to support their business objectives. Technical Proficiency - Utilizes knowledge to develop or install appropriate computer software. Serves as a resource on data processing systems and procedures. On-call Support - Provides 24/7 on-call support via rotation. Position Specific Skills: Experience with programming languages such as Microsoft .NET (C#); ASP.NET Core; JavaScript; HTML 5; XML; SQL Scripting and Powershell Scripting Experience with Microsoft Team Foundation Server (TFS) or similar code repository system Experience with ServiceNow or other information technology service ticketing systems Knowledge of System Life Cycle Development methodology (like Waterfall and Agile) Ability to be on call 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, on a rotating basis Qualifications: Minimum Required Education and Experience: Bachelor's Degree and 2 years' experience OR High School Diploma or GED/Equivalent and 6 years' experience in Application software programming Preferred Education:Other Preferred Area of Study:Computer Science Preferred Area of Experience:MS.NET; ASP.NET; SQL Scripting; Powershell Scripting Required Licenses or Certifications: Preferred Licenses or Certifications: Additional Information Bachelor's Degree and 2 years of experience in Software application development and maintenance OR High School Diploma or GED and 8 years of experience in Software application development and maintenance
